WebClick Start and type: %temp% into the Search box and hit Enter. The Temp folder opens. Hit [Ctrl][A] to select all of the files. Then hit [Delete] or right-click and select Delete from the context menu. Click Yes to the verification message. You’ll get a message that certain running system files can’t be deleted. Click Skip.
